Asp.Net是如何进行Form认证的?
1、终端用户在浏览器的帮助下,发送Form认证请求。
2、浏览器会发送存储在客户端的所有相关的用户数据。
3、当服务器端接收到请求时,服务器会检测请求,查看是否存在 “Authentication Cookie”的Cookie。
4、如果查找到认证Cookie,服务器会识别用户,验证用户是否合法。
5、如果为找到“Authentication Cookie”,服务器会将用户作为匿名(未认证)用户处理,在这种情况下,如果请求的资源标记着 protected/secured,用户将会重定位到登录页面。
本文介绍了Asp.Net进行Form认证的流程。终端用户通过浏览器发送认证请求,浏览器会发送相关用户数据。服务器接收请求后,检测是否存在“Authentication Cookie”,若有则识别验证用户,若没有则将用户作为匿名用户处理,请求受保护资源时会重定向到登录页面。
3398





